What the college says
Working to high industry standards the Level 3 provides you with a range of skills including the diagnosis of complex system faults and advanced systems operation, advanced systems operation, multi-step diagnostic repair and transmission systems. Assessments will be through a combination of practical tasks on motor vehicles and rigs, online tests and written assignment. Students will also work within our new classroom dedicated to hybrid and electrical training as well as completing work placement opportunities with local employers.
What you need to get on
L2 Maintenance & Repair qualification or equivalent. GCSE Grade 4 or above in English and maths.
